专业接各种小工具软件及爬虫软件开发,联系Q:2391047879

桌面便签备忘录工具(基于Tkinter)

发布时间: 2025-03-28 19:24:01 浏览量: 本文共包含940个文字,预计阅读时间3分钟

清晨阳光斜射进办公室的玻璃窗,程序员李明习惯性双击桌面上那个黄色图标——这是他用Python+Tkinter独立开发的桌面便签工具。相比市面复杂的办公软件,这个仅3MB大小、无需联网的程序,在过去三年里默默承载了他2371条工作备忘。

桌面便签备忘录工具(基于Tkinter)

基于Tkinter框架构建的便签工具天生具备跨平台优势。在Windows系统任务栏右侧,MacOS的菜单栏上方,或是Linux发行版的Dock栏里,都能见到其简约的纯色图标。这种与操作系统深度融合的特性,使得用户点击即用,无需在多个窗口间频繁切换。核心功能设计遵循"二八定律":80%高频需求占据主界面,20%低频功能隐藏于右键菜单。

文本存储机制采用了本地加密的SQLite数据库。每条便签在输入框失去焦点的0.5秒后自动保存,既避免了频繁写入对系统资源的消耗,又确保突发断电时的数据安全。对于需要长期追踪的任务,用户可通过标签实现跨便签内容聚合,这种去中心化的管理方式比传统文件夹分类更灵活。

界面美学方面,开发者刻意保留了上世纪90年代的GUI设计元素。可调节透明度的亚克力材质面板,配合不超过三种的主色调选择,有效降低视觉疲劳。某位UX设计师用户在GitHub的issue中留言:"它的复古感恰到好处,就像纸质便利贴之于电子屏,能触发更深层的记忆锚点。

开源社区贡献了诸多实用插件:语音输入转文字、Markdown渲染引擎、番茄钟整合模块。这些扩展组件通过独立的配置文件加载,既保持了核心程序的精简,又满足了进阶用户的个性化需求。有开发者尝试接入大语言模型API,实验结果证明,AI生成的待办事项与实际完成率的相关系数仅为0.32,远低于人工录入的0.79。

隐私保护机制采用零信任架构,所有数据存储于本地AppData目录。当检测到网络连接时,程序会自动禁用云同步相关的实验性功能,这个设计细节在欧盟GDPR合规审查中获得好评。便携模式可将整个程序打包成单个EXE文件,U盘即插即用的特性使其在涉密单位仍有生存空间。

夜间模式切换时的色温变化曲线经过光学实验室校准,避免影响用户褪黑素分泌。对于需要多屏协作的股票交易员,工具支持在六个显示器之间同步显示关键备忘,这个功能源自某私募基金经理的定制需求。数据统计显示,用户平均每天激活程序11.7次,单次使用时长不超过87秒,印证了碎片化信息处理的现代工作特征。

字体渲染引擎兼容从思源宋体到Fira Code等编程字体,等宽与非等宽字体的混合排版支持,让代码片段与自然语言得以和谐共存。有个别用户坚持使用初代版本的像素字体,开发者为此保留了位图字体渲染接口,这种对技术遗产的尊重在更新日志中被标注为"文化兼容性维护"。

安装包的数字签名证书每年更新,但版本号始终停留在1.0。开发者认为,当软件解决的是恒久存在的需求时,没必要用版本迭代制造升级焦虑。病毒扫描误报率控制在0.03%以下,这个成绩在同类开源工具中保持领先。用户留存数据揭示,五年以上活跃用户中,68%从未尝试过其他同类软件。

当微软开始将便签工具集成Copilot,当Notion等在线文档加入AI助手,这类离线工具的价值反而愈加凸显。在东京某证券公司的灾备预案中,Tkinter便签与应急电源、卫星电话并列重要办公设备。某次纽约大停电事故中,交易员们依靠该工具的离线功能完成了价值47亿美元的头寸转移。